> > we want to implement break iteration for Khmer in OpenOffice. We created a > > patch for ICU to implement a dictionary base breakiterator and so far this > > seems to work for line breaking. Are you sure ICU will need modifications for that? For Japanese and Chinese we already have dictionary based breakiterators, see source in i18npool/source/breakiterator/, especially breakiterator_cjk.cxx; probably similar can be added to breakiterator_ctl.cxx or be built upon. > > Unfortunately it is not working for word breaking. :-( > > > > From the code in OOo we got the impression that for word breaking always > > rule > > based iterators are used. > > > > Has anyone experience in this field and can tell us what we need to do in > > order to use an iterator from ICU for word breaking? > > Please contact Karl Hong (Karl Hong <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>) he implemented > the breakiterator in i18npool and is probably the most familiar with the > ICU.
